Transaction edd14815803173fc7c80989f748ca19ddcf77c7559214d2efa4b07934be6e8bc
1 Input
1 Output
-
edd14815803173fc7c80989f748ca19ddcf77c7559214d2efa4b07934be6e8bc:0
- value
- 33086
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ff23e18c536dc9764ab69a151a3f257a16f4ea2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18HiaTrx89r5yoqLuaKUfVPKBJ7zKrpYPc